The Ultimate Guide to Lightweight All Terrain Strollers: Finding the Perfect Companion for Adventurous FamiliesAs families start brand-new adventures, the requirement for a stroller that can manage various surfaces while remaining lightweight and portable becomes vital. Lightweight all-terrain strollers are a popular choice among parents who desire the flexibility to explore both urban environments and the outdoors without sacrificing benefit and convenience for their youngsters. This post will explore the functions, benefits, and buying considerations for lightweight all-terrain strollers.What is a Lightweight All Terrain Stroller?A lightweight all-terrain stroller integrates the advantages of portability and flexibility. These strollers are designed to browse diverse surface areas, such as gravel, grass, and rough paths while being light enough for moms and dads to bring quickly. They typically feature strong wheels, long lasting products, and a simple folding mechanism, making them best for on-the-go households.Key Features to Look ForWhen selecting an all-terrain stroller, it is important to consider a number of elements to ensure it meets your family's needs. Below is a table highlighting crucial features to search for:FeatureDescriptionWeightOught to weigh between 14-22 pounds to be easily portableWheel TypeLarger, air-filled or rubber tires for dealing with different surfacesSuspensionShock-absorbing mechanisms for a smooth rideFolding MechanismOne-handed folding abilities for convenienceHandle HeightAdjustable handles for parents of various heightsStorage SpaceAmple storage baskets or pockets for fundamentalsHarness System5-point harness for included securityCanopyUV protection and adjustable canopies for convenienceToughnessPremium fabrics that are water-resistant and simple to tidyAdvantages of Choosing a Lightweight All Terrain StrollerPurchasing a lightweight all-terrain stroller offers numerous benefits for active households. Here are some crucial benefits:Versatility: These strollers can transition easily from city streets to rocky trails, making them perfect for families on the go.Ease of Use: The lightweight design enables simple maneuverability and transportation, whether by automobile, public transit, or throughout outside activities.Comfort: With features such as suspension systems and cushioned seating, these strollers ensure a comfy trip for both infants and toddlers.Storage Options: Many lightweight all-terrain strollers come with spacious storage baskets, making it easy to pack all essentials for trips.Security Features: All-terrain strollers regularly include necessary security functions like a 5-point harness and brakes, supplying assurance for parents.Contrast of Popular Lightweight All Terrain StrollersTo assist with the choice procedure, we've compiled a comparison table highlighting some popular lightweight all-terrain strollers offered in the market.Stroller ModelWeightWheel TypeFold TypeCost RangeBOB Revolution Flex 3.025 poundsPneumaticOne-hand fold₤ 450 - ₤ 500Thule Urban Glide 224 poundsAir-filledOne-hand fold₤ 450 - ₤ 500Baby Jogger Summit X327 poundsAll-terrainOne-handed fast fold₤ 400 - ₤ 450Chicco Bravo Quick-Fold22 lbsPlasticOne-hand fast fold₤ 300 - ₤ 350Joovy Zoom 360 Ultralight25 poundsEVAOne-hand fold₤ 300 - ₤ 350Often Asked Questions (FAQ)1. What age appropriates for utilizing an all-terrain stroller?All-terrain strollers are typically appropriate for kids from birth approximately around 5 years old. Lots of models feature baby safety seat compatibility or recline function, allowing their usage from infancy.2. Can lightweight all-terrain strollers be utilized for jogging?Some models, such as the BOB Revolution Flex and Thule Urban Glide, are particularly developed for running. However, always examine the producer's specs to make sure that it is safe for jogging.3. Are all-terrain strollers heavy?Not necessarily! A lightweight all-terrain stroller generally weighs between 14-27 pounds, distinguishing it from basic all-terrain strollers which can be bulkier.4. Can I use a lightweight all-terrain stroller on rough terrain?Yes, these strollers are developed to handle a variety of terrains, including gravel, grass, and dirt courses, making them suitable for outdoor experiences.5. How compact are lightweight all-terrain strollers when folded?The majority of lightweight all-terrain strollers include a one-handed folding system that enables them to be compact and easy to store in cars or tight areas.Lightweight all-terrain strollers are an excellent financial investment for households who delight in an active way of life but decline to jeopardize on convenience and security. With their mix of toughness, simple maneuverability, and convenience, these strollers can deal with a myriad of environments, making them a reputable buddy for all your family adventures. By thinking about the crucial functions and comparing popular models, moms and dads can find the ideal stroller to suit their distinct needs.Whether you're strolling through your area, treking a forest trail, or visiting an amusement park, a Lightweight All Terrain Stroller all-terrain stroller opens a world of exploration for both parents and their youngsters.
